Lightweight

The electric wheelchair is similar to a power chair but smaller and lighter. This makes it easier to move around. They are powered by rechargeable batteries and are controlled with a joystick control. They are an excellent option for individuals who lack the strength or mobility needed to propel manually in a wheelchair. These chairs are available at local health shops and specialty mobility equipment stores or directly from the manufacturers. It is recommended to consult an expert in mobility or a medical expert prior to making a wheelchair purchase to ensure it meets your specific requirements and preferences. It is also essential to think about other options for customization, such as armrest height, seat height and control panel placement that can affect the user's functionality and comfort.

The most lightweight electric wheelchairs are made to improve the quality of life for users and enable them to move more easily and participate in social activities they would otherwise not be able to attend. These models are also highly adaptable and can navigate through a variety of surfaces and environments, including indoor and outdoor environments. They can be used to transport passengers on public transportation.

Lightweight wheelchairs are typically cheaper than traditional power chairs. They are also more durable and require less maintenance than their larger counterparts. They can be folded and stored in small spaces. If you want to maximize their portability should think about purchasing an electric wheelchair with wheels that can be detached that can be removed and replaced for storage or transportation.

Easy to transport

A portable electric wheelchair can be a game changer for people with mobility challenges. It allows them to explore new areas, travel to events, and have fun with family and friends. But a portable electric wheelchair isn't only about convenience and mobility. It can improve the quality of life of the users by removing the need for physical exertion and reducing fatigue. It can also improve their social interactions, and enable them to participate in hobbies, school and work activities more easily.

Lightweight wheelchairs are much easier to transport than traditional wheelchairs. This is especially true when they can fold. They can be transported easily in vehicles that are not adapted, and they take up less room in hotel rooms as well as aircraft hold and ship cabins. They can also be transported in the back of vans or pickup trucks. Take a look at the dimensions of the folding wheelchair and determine if it is able to disassemble it. If not, it might be necessary to purchase an ramp or vehicle lift to aid in loading and unloading.

When selecting a portable wheelchair, you should also consider its weight capacity. A lightweight wheelchair must be able to carry the weight of its user as well as any other items they might be carrying around. This includes luggage, bags and other accessories. It should also be able move through tight spaces without any problems.

It's also important to look at the safety features of an electric wheelchair. This includes safety brakes, seat belts and anti-tip wheels. Some models also come with adjustable settings to suit the user's preferences and comfort including the seat height, armrest location, and control panel position. Before purchasing a wheelchair, it is a good idea to check the warranty and after-sales support.

Portable electric wheelchairs are designed to satisfy a variety of needs, including those with limited space or budget. Some can be folded down to a compact size that fits into most automobiles. Durable

A lightweight electric wheelchair is designed to be durable and withstand regular usage. Its robust frame and premium components help it resist wear and tear, particularly when used on rough terrains. It also has anti-tip wheels and brakes to ensure user safety. Most of these wheelchairs are compact which makes them easy to move and use. They can fit easily in cars and public transportation which makes them a great option for frequent travelers.

The lightweight electric wheelchairs are constructed from aircraft-grade aluminium alloy, which is tough and strong enough to stand up to the pressure. In addition, they feature an ultra-lightweight battery that helps reduce the weight overall. This allows you to move the chair in tight spaces and environments. The cushions are of high quality and are designed to prevent bedroosing and seat deformation.

Certain manufacturers offer their customers customizable options, such as adjustable settings for the height of the seat and armrest positioning. This lets them find the best possible mobility solution for their needs. They also have advanced joystick controls that allow for simple operation. It is crucial to consider how frequently the chair is used when selecting a model, since it will impact its durability and battery life.

If you are planning to travel using an electric wheelchair, select one that is easy to disassemble or fold. This way, it will be much easier to put the chair into your car or trunk and save space when it's stored. Additionally, it's beneficial to choose an item that is TSA and airline-approved.

Depending on the frequency you utilize your wheelchair, it's crucial to consider the terrain you'll travel over and the kinds of surfaces it will be exposed to. Rough terrains can cause significant wear and tear on the chair, whereas smooth surfaces are more comfortable to navigate. In addition, it's also vital to inspect the requirements for maintenance of the chair. Regularly schedule professional inspections so that any issues can be identified before they become more severe.
